diff --git a/templates/layouts/partials/helpers/treeview.jet.html b/templates/layouts/partials/helpers/treeview.jet.html index db837624..83022fa4 100644 --- a/templates/layouts/partials/helpers/treeview.jet.html +++ b/templates/layouts/partials/helpers/treeview.jet.html @@ -1,7 +1,7 @@ {{ block make_treeview(treeviewData=nil) }} {{ if isset(treeviewData)}} {{ range index, folder := treeviewData.Folder.Folders }} - {{ folderId := IdentifierChain+"_"+index }} + {{ folderId := treeviewData.IdentifierChain+"_"+index }} {{ fileSize(folder.TotalSize, T) }} @@ -10,7 +10,7 @@ - {{ yield make_treeview(treeviewData=makeTreeViewData(folder, treeviewData.NestLevel, T, folderId)) }} + {{ yield make_treeview(treeviewData=makeTreeViewData(folder, treeviewData.NestLevel, folderId)) }}
diff --git a/templates/site/torrents/view.jet.html b/templates/site/torrents/view.jet.html index 8409c170..d72bf284 100644 --- a/templates/site/torrents/view.jet.html +++ b/templates/site/torrents/view.jet.html @@ -77,7 +77,7 @@ {{ T("size")}} - {{ yield make_treeview(treeviewData=makeTreeViewData(RootFolder, 0, T, "root")) }} + {{ yield make_treeview(treeviewData=makeTreeViewData(RootFolder, 0, "root")) }} {{ else }} diff --git a/templates/template_functions.go b/templates/template_functions.go index d7aff079..552e2e85 100644 --- a/templates/template_functions.go +++ b/templates/template_functions.go @@ -221,13 +221,12 @@ func defaultUserSettings(s string) bool { return config.Get().Users.DefaultUserSettings[s] } -func makeTreeViewData(f *filelist.FileListFolder, nestLevel int, T publicSettings.TemplateTfunc, identifierChain string) interface{} { +func makeTreeViewData(f *filelist.FileListFolder, nestLevel int, identifierChain string) interface{} { return struct { Folder *filelist.FileListFolder NestLevel int - T publicSettings.TemplateTfunc IdentifierChain string - }{f, nestLevel, T, identifierChain} + }{f, nestLevel, identifierChain} } func lastID(currentURL *url.URL, torrents []models.TorrentJSON) int { if len(torrents) == 0 {